"Webcomics" is an introduction to one of today's fastest growing and most exciting areas of publishing-online comics. Created digitally and distributed on the Internet - sometimes for free, sometimes on subscription - webcomics represent both a new type of publishing and a brand new art form. They range in style from traditional-looking cartoon strips to innovative, experimental works that may integrate imagery from photography, video, and other sources, and feature audio soundtracks, animation, and interactivity. "Webcomics" offers an in-depth look at what is happening in this area - revealing who the pioneers are, what sort of work they're doing, and what kind of digital tools and techniques they employ. Combining profiles of well-known webcomics creators with detailed workthroughs that reveal the nuts and bolts of every aspect of comic creation and presentation, this book is a must for anyone interested in where comics are headed in the 21st century.
